Bbq Fan Airflow Basics
Airflowcontrols how smoke and heat move inside a BBQ smoker. It helps keep the fire burning and the meat cooking evenly. Without good airflow, the fire can die out or produce too much smoke.
Different fans create different airflow speeds and pressures. The right airflow makes smoking easier and more consistent.
| Type of BBQ Fan | Description | Best For |
|---|---|---|
| Battery-Powered Fan | Runs on batteries, easy to carry and use. | Small smokers and outdoor use. |
| Electric Fan | Plug-in fan with steady airflow control. | Longer smoking sessions, more control. |
| Handheld Fan | Manual fan to blow air into the fire. | Quick airflow boost, simple and cheap. |

Adjusting Fan Speed And Settings
Variable speed controls help adjust the bbq fan airfloweasily. Different speeds change the amount of air flowing through the fan. This controls how hot or cool the smoker stays.
Use lower speeds for slow smoking. It keeps the temperature steady and smoke flavor rich. Higher speeds work well for faster cookingor when you need more heat.
- Start with a medium fan speed.
- Watch the smoker’s temperature gauge.
- Adjust speed to raise or lower heat.
- Keep airflow steady for even cooking.
Changing the fan speed lets you match airflowto weather and food type. Wind or cold weather may need higher speeds. Warm days or delicate meats need lower airflow to avoid drying out.
Troubleshooting Common Issues
Low airflowin a BBQ fan can be caused by clogged vents or dirty blades. Clean the fan blades and vents to improve airflow. Check for obstructions that block air movement. Also, ensure the fan is properly installed and not too far from the heat source.
Fan noise and vibrationmight indicate loose parts or worn bearings. Tighten screws and bolts to reduce noise. If vibration continues, inspect the fan blades for damage or imbalance. Replace any broken parts to keep the fan running smoothly.
Electrical and power concernscan affect fan performance. Confirm the power source is stable and matches the fan’s voltage needs. Check wires and connections for damage or loose contacts. Replace frayed cables and secure all connections to avoid power loss.
Maintaining Consistent Smoke Control
Testing your BBQ fan airflow regularly keeps the smoke steady and controlled. Consistent smoke means better flavor and safer cooking. Set a schedule to check the fan’s airflow at least once a month. Use a simple airflow meter or observe the smoke flow during cooking. Watch for weak or uneven airflow which can spoil the smoke quality.
Cleaning the fan is key. Dust and grease buildup block airflow and reduce efficiency. Wipe fan blades and vents with a damp cloth. Avoid harsh chemicals that may damage parts. Lubricate moving parts to keep the fan running smoothly. Check the power source and wires for safety.
| Task | Frequency | Notes |
|---|---|---|
| Airflow Testing | Monthly | Use airflow meter or smoke observation |
| Fan Cleaning | Every 2 weeks | Wipe blades and vents, avoid harsh cleaners |
| Lubrication | Quarterly | Apply light oil to moving parts |
| Power Check | Monthly | Inspect wires and connections |
